The crystal structure of wild type PA endonuclease (2009/H1N1/CALIFORNIA) in complex with SJ000986436

The crystal structure of wild type PA endonuclease (2009/H1N1/CALIFORNIA) in complex with SJ000986436 Descriptor: 5-hydroxy-N-[2-(4-hydroxy-3-methoxyphenyl)ethyl]-6-oxo-2-[2-(trifluoromethyl)phenyl]-1,6-dihydropyrimidine-4-carboxamide, Hexa Vinylpyrrolidone K15, MANGANESE (II) ION, ... Authors: Cuypers, M.G, Slavish, J.P, Rankovic, Z, White, S.W. Deposit date: 2021-05-04 Release date: 2022-05-04 Last modified: 2023-11-22 Method: X-RAY DIFFRACTION (2.8 Å) Cite: Chemical scaffold recycling: Structure-guided conversion of an HIV integrase inhibitor into a potent influenza virus RNA-dependent RNA polymerase inhibitor designed to minimize resistance potential. Eur.J.Med.Chem., 247, 2023
